Day 1,REYKJAVIKArrival day.
Day 2,GULFOSS - GEYSIRTake in some of the best known attractions in the south of Iceland, including the implosion crater Kerio, the great Geysir area and Gullfoss waterfall. Overnight by Geysir.
Day 3,HIGHLAND ROUTE - AKUREYRITraverse the interior by driving over the highland route Kjolur, taking us right between two of Europe’s largest glaciers, Langjokull and Hofsjokull, and through the geothermal area Hveravellir. Overnight in Akureyri.
Day 4,LAKE MYVATNStart the day in Akureyri, the ‘capital of North Iceland’ before visiting the waterfall Godafoss en route to Lake Myvatn. Overnight by Lake Myvatn.
Day 5,LAKE MYVATNSpend the day exploring the natural wonders that surround Lake Myvatn, including the lavamaze Dimmuborgir and Dettifoss, Europe’s most powerful waterfall.
Day 6,REYKHOLTVisit the Glaumbaer folk museum by Varmahlid on your way to Reykholt, the cradle of Scandinavian literature, where some of the famous Icelandic sagas were written.
Day 7,THINGVELLIR - REYKJAVIKWe visit the waterfalls Hraunfossar and Barnafoss before heading via the barren Kaldidalur mountain road, one of Iceland’s highest routes, to the ancient parliament site Thingvellir National Park. Tonight we return to Reykjavik.
Day 8,REYKJAVIKTour ends.
